Jet Washing in Hatfield: what actually matters here
A new town grafted onto an estate village, with the university at College Lane, the old town below Hatfield House, and a large redevelopment belt on the former aerodrome at Hatfield Business Park.
The housing stock is 1950s new-town terraces at South Hatfield, student and shared housing around the university, and 2000s–2010s houses and apartments on the former aerodrome, which decides the tools, protection and crew size we bring to a jet washing job.
University tenancy changeovers in June and September saturate the calendar and the streets around College Lane, and the aerodrome-era estates have parking courts and controlled barriers, so we confirm access codes and book those weeks early.
Hatfield is quoted as a whole: Old Hatfield, South Hatfield, Birchwood and Ellenbrook are on the same jet washing rate as anywhere else inside AL9 and AL10.

What a jet washing job includes
Jet washing is exterior pressure cleaning for hard surfaces — driveways, patios, paths, steps, walls and decking. The method matters more than the machine: block paving and concrete take a rotary flat-surface cleaner at working pressure, while render, painted masonry and older slabs take a soft wash with a cleaning solution and low pressure, because a lance held too close permanently scars soft stone and blows the joints out of paving.
Before the machine starts
- Surface identified and tested on a low-visibility area to set the right pressure
- Loose growth, moss and debris swept and scraped off
- Drains, gullies and airbricks covered so run-off silt does not block them
- Doors, windows, planting and neighbouring boundaries screened
The clean
- Rotary flat-surface cleaning for an even finish without the striping a hand lance leaves
- Edges, steps, kerbs and awkward corners detailed by hand lance
- Weeds and moss taken out of joints as the surface is worked
- Soft-wash treatment on render, painted brick and anything the pressure test says is too soft for the lance
Finishing
- Silt and run-off rinsed off and swept, not left on the lawn or the pavement
- Kiln-dried sand re-brushed into block-paving joints where the joints were washed out
- Site left tidy with covers removed and drains checked clear
What changes the price on a jet washing job
- Re-sanding matters. Washing block paving without re-brushing kiln-dried sand into the joints invites weeds straight back and lets the blocks move.
- Weather changes the result rather than the price — a cold, wet week means a longer drying window before any sealing could be considered.
- Pressure washing cleans; it does not restore. Where paving has permanently discoloured, spalled or been stained by oil or rust, it will come up cleaner but not new, and we say which of yours is which before we start.
- Old and soft surfaces set the pressure. Loose-jointed or poorly laid paving, soft sandstone and Victorian tile can be damaged by full pressure, so those are soft-washed and take longer.
- Water and drainage come from the property unless we agree otherwise. If there is no outside tap or the drains cannot take run-off, tell us at quote stage and we plan for it.

Will jet washing damage my paving?
Not at the right pressure for the surface, which is why we test first. Full pressure on soft stone, loose-jointed slabs or lime mortar does cause damage, so those get a low-pressure soft wash instead — a technique change, not an upsell.
Do you re-sand block paving afterwards?
Yes, where the joints have been washed out. Kiln-dried sand is brushed back in as part of the job, because paving left with open joints loses stability and grows weeds again within weeks.
Do you seal the surface as well?
Sealing is a separate decision and needs a properly dry surface, so it is never done on the same visit as the wash. We will tell you honestly whether your surface would benefit rather than adding it by default.
